// This file is part of the OWASP O2 Platform (http://www.owasp.org/index.php/OWASP_O2_Platform) and is released under the Apache 2.0 License (http://www.apache.org/licenses/LICENSE-2.0)
using System;
using System.IO;
using System.Text;
using System.Linq;
using System.Reflection;
using System.Collections.Generic;
using System.Windows.Forms;
using System.Xml.Serialization;
using FluentSharp.CoreLib;
using FluentSharp.CoreLib.API;
using FluentSharp.CoreLib.Interfaces;
using FluentSharp.REPL;
using FluentSharp.REPL.Controls;
using FluentSharp.WinForms;
using FluentSharp.WinForms.Controls;
using Microsoft.ACESec.CATNet.Core.Driver;
using O2.Scanner.MsCatNet.Converter;
using O2.XRules.Database.Findings;
using Rules = Microsoft.ACESec.CATNet.Core.Rules;
//Installer:CatNet_Installer.cs!CatNet_1.1/SourceDir/Microsoft.ACESec.CATNet.Core.dll
//O2File:Findings_ExtensionMethods.cs
//O2File:MsCatNetScanner.cs
//O2Ref:CatNet_1.1/SourceDir/Microsoft.ACESec.CATNet.Core.dll
namespace O2.XRules.Database.APIs
{
public class API_CatNet
{
public Engine Engine { get; set; }
public CatNetEvents EventsLog { get; set; }
public string Rules_Folder { get; set; }
public API_CatNet()
{
Engine = Engine.Create(EngineType.Builtin);
EventsLog = new CatNetEvents();
Engine.EventSink = EventsLog;
Rules_Folder = this.engineDirectory().pathCombine("Rules");
var tempReportFile = "_catNet_reports".tempDir(false)
.pathCombine(10.randomLetters() + ".xml");
this.save_Report_To(tempReportFile);
}
}
public class CatNetEvents : EventSink
{
public StringBuilder OutputLines { get; set;}
public bool ShowDebugEvents { get; set; }
public CatNetEvents()
{
OutputLines = new StringBuilder();
ShowDebugEvents = false;
}
public override void AssemblyLoadFailure(string path)
{
"[CatNetEvents] AssemblyLoadFailure: {0}".error(path);
}
public override void Output(EventSink.OutputType type, string format, params object[] p)
{
if (type == EventSink.OutputType.Debug && ShowDebugEvents.isFalse())
return;
var outputLine = "{0} : {1}".format(type, format.format(p));
OutputLines.AppendLine(outputLine);
"[CatNetEvents] {0}".info(outputLine);
}
}
public static class API_CatNet_ExtensionMethods_Setup
{
public static API_CatNet loadRules(this API_CatNet catNet)
{
catNet.Engine.RulesEngine.LoadDirectory(catNet.Rules_Folder);
return catNet;
}
public static List<Rules.Rule> rules(this API_CatNet catNet)
{
return catNet.Engine.RulesEngine.Rules.toList();
}
public static List<string> rules_Names(this API_CatNet catNet)
{
return (from rule in catNet.rules()
select rule.Info.Name).toList();
}
public static Rules.Rule rule(this API_CatNet catNet, string ruleName)
{
return (from rule in catNet.rules()
where rule.Info.Name == ruleName
select rule).first();
}
public static string engineDirectory(this API_CatNet catNet)
{
return catNet.Engine.type().Assembly.Location.directoryName();
}
}
public static class API_CatNet_ExtensionMethods_Scan
{
public static API_CatNet scan(this API_CatNet catNet, string file)
{
return catNet.analyze(file);
}
public static API_CatNet analyze(this API_CatNet catNet, string file)
{
var o2Timer = new O2Timer("Scanned file in :").start();
catNet.Engine.Analyze(file);
o2Timer.stop();
catNet.Engine.AnalysisEngine.ResetState();
return catNet;
}
public static string output(this API_CatNet catNet)
{
return catNet.EventsLog.OutputLines.str();
}
public static string savedReport(this API_CatNet catNet)
{
return catNet.Engine.Configuration.ReportFile;
}
public static API_CatNet save_Report_To(this API_CatNet catNet, string file)
{
file.deleteIfExists();
catNet.Engine.Configuration.ReportFile = file;
catNet.Engine.Configuration.ReportXslOutputFile = file + ".html";
return catNet;
}
public static API_CatNet save_GraphML_To(this API_CatNet catNet, string file)
{
catNet.Engine.Configuration.DataFlowGraphFile = file;
return catNet;
}
}
public static class API_CatNet_ExtensionMethods_Scan_Direclty
{
public static API_CatNet scan_Assembly(this API_CatNet catNet, Assembly assemblyToScan)
{
return catNet.scan(assemblyToScan);
}
public static API_CatNet scan(this API_CatNet catNet, Assembly assemblyToScan)
{
return catNet.scan(new List<Assembly>().add(assemblyToScan));
}
public static API_CatNet scan(this API_CatNet catNet, List<Assembly> assembliesToScan)
{
return catNet.analyze(assembliesToScan);
}
public static API_CatNet analyze(this API_CatNet catNet, List<Assembly> assembliesToScan)
{
var o2Timer = new O2Timer("Scanned assembly in :").start();
try
{
var analysisEngine = catNet.Engine.AnalysisEngine;
analysisEngine.BeginAnalysis();
var cci = "CatNet_1.1/SourceDir/Microsoft.Cci.dll".assembly();
var assemblyNode = cci.type("AssemblyNode");
foreach(var assemblyToScan in assembliesToScan)
{
var module = assemblyNode.invokeStatic("GetAssembly", assemblyToScan, null, true,true,true);
if (module.notNull())
{
analysisEngine.invoke("AnalyzeModule", module);
}
else
"[API_CatNet][analyze] could not get Module for provided assembly: {0}".error(assemblyToScan);
}
analysisEngine.FinalizeState();
catNet.Engine.RulesEngine.Process(analysisEngine);
analysisEngine.EndAnalysis();
catNet.Engine.SaveReport();
analysisEngine.ResetState();
o2Timer.stop();
}
catch(Exception ex)
{
ex.log("[API_CatNet][analyze] assembly");
}
return catNet;
}
}
public static class API_CatNet_ExtensionMethods_Scan_O2Findings
{
public static List<IO2Finding> findings(this string reportFile)
{
var findingsFile = "{0}.findings".format(reportFile);
findingsFile.deleteIfExists();
var catNetConverter = new CatNetConverter(reportFile);
catNetConverter.convert(findingsFile);
if (findingsFile.fileExists())
return findingsFile.loadFindingsFile();
return new List<IO2Finding>();
}
public static ascx_FindingsViewer add_CatNet_FindingsViewer(this Control control, string reportFile, SourceCodeEditor codeEditor = null)
{
var findingsViewer = control.control<ascx_FindingsViewer>();
if (findingsViewer.notNull())
{
findingsViewer.clearO2Findings();
findingsViewer.load(reportFile.findings());
return findingsViewer;
}
control.clear();
findingsViewer = control.add_FindingsViewer(codeEditor.isNull())
.load(reportFile.findings());
return findingsViewer;
}
public static ascx_FindingsViewer show(this API_CatNet catNet, Control control, SourceCodeEditor codeEditor = null)
{
var reportFile = catNet.Engine.Configuration.ReportFile;
if (reportFile.valid())
return control.add_CatNet_FindingsViewer(reportFile, codeEditor);
return null;
}
}
public class API_CatNet_Deployment
{
public static bool ensure_CatNet_Instalation()
{
unzipEmbeddedResourceToFolder("CatNet_Files.zip" , @"..\_ToolsOrAPIs\CatNet_1.1");
var result = @"CatNet_1.1\SourceDir\Microsoft.ACESec.CATNet.Core.dll".assembly().notNull();
if (result)
"CatNet is Installed OK".debug();
else
"CatNet is NOT Installed correctly".error();
return result;
}
public static bool ensure_CatNet_Data()
{
return unzipEmbeddedResourceToFolder("LocalScriptsFolder.zip" , PublicDI.config.LocalScriptsFolder);
}
public static bool unzipEmbeddedResourceToFolder(string resourceToUnzip, string virtalPathToTargetFolder)
{
var assembly = System.Reflection.Assembly.GetEntryAssembly();
var targetFile = PublicDI.config.O2TempDir.pathCombine(resourceToUnzip);
var targetFolder = PublicDI.config.O2TempDir.pathCombine(virtalPathToTargetFolder);
if (targetFile.fileExists().isFalse())
{
foreach (var resourceName in assembly.GetManifestResourceNames())
{
"resourceName: {0}".debug(resourceName);
if (resourceName == resourceToUnzip)
{
"Extracting embeded reference and saving it to: {0}".info(targetFile);
var assemblyStream = assembly.GetManifestResourceStream(resourceName);
byte[] data = new BinaryReader(assemblyStream).ReadBytes((int)assemblyStream.Length);
Files.WriteFileContent(targetFile,data);
"unzing to: {0}".info(targetFolder);
targetFile.unzip_File(targetFolder.createDir());
}
}
}
if (targetFile.fileExists() && targetFolder.dirExists())
return true;
"requested embedded resource was not found: {0}".info(resourceToUnzip);
return false;
}
}
[XmlRoot("CatNetRules")]
public class CatNet_Rules_Mappings : List<Rule_Mapping>
{
}
[XmlRoot("Mapping")]
public class Rule_Mapping
{
[XmlAttribute] public string VulnName { get ; set; }
[XmlAttribute] public string Target { get ; set; }
}
public static class CatNet_Rules_Mappings_ExtensionMethods
{
public static CatNet_Rules_Mappings add(this CatNet_Rules_Mappings rulesMappings, string vulnName, string target)
{
rulesMappings.Add(new Rule_Mapping() { VulnName = vulnName, Target = target });
return rulesMappings;
}
public static string item(this CatNet_Rules_Mappings rulesMappings, string vulnName)
{
return rulesMappings.Where((mapping)=>mapping.VulnName == vulnName)
.Select((mapping)=> mapping.Target).first();
}
public static bool hasItem(this CatNet_Rules_Mappings rulesMappings, string vulnName)
{
return rulesMappings.item(vulnName).notNull();
}
}
}
